413043623 has 2 divisors, whose sum is σ = 413043624. Its totient is φ = 413043622.
The previous prime is 413043599. The next prime is 413043649. The reversal of 413043623 is 326340314.
It is a happy number.
It is an a-pointer prime, because the next prime (413043649) can be obtained adding 413043623 to its sum of digits (26).
It is a weak prime.
It is a cyclic number.
It is not a de Polignac number, because 413043623 - 210 = 413042599 is a prime.
It is a super-2 number, since 2×4130436232 = 341210069001932258, which contains 22 as substring.
It is a Sophie Germain prime.
It is a junction number, because it is equal to n+sod(n) for n = 413043592 and 413043601.
It is a congruent number.
It is not a weakly prime, because it can be changed into another prime (413043023) by changing a digit.
It is a polite number, since it can be written as a sum of consecutive naturals, namely, 206521811 + 206521812.
It is an arithmetic number, because the mean of its divisors is an integer number (206521812).
Almost surely, 2413043623 is an apocalyptic number.
413043623 is a deficient number, since it is larger than the sum of its proper divisors (1).
413043623 is an equidigital number, since it uses as much as digits as its factorization.
413043623 is an evil number, because the sum of its binary digits is even.
The product of its (nonzero) digits is 5184, while the sum is 26.
The square root of 413043623 is about 20323.4746783123. The cubic root of 413043623 is about 744.7296426027.
Adding to 413043623 its reverse (326340314), we get a palindrome (739383937).
The spelling of 413043623 in words is "four hundred thirteen million, forty-three thousand, six hundred twenty-three".
